    Postilion Operations Manager

    Job Description

    This purpose of this position is to effectively manage the Postilion Real-time switch, PostOffice system and other related systems, servers and appliances.

    Over and above the “business as usual” processing operations, this position will oversee the implementation of new products and processing requirements as well as work closely with business to improve the customer experience on any of Paycorp’s transaction channels.

    The responsibilities of the position include:

    Postilion Team

    • Providing technical guidance around the Postilion system
    • Providing technical guidance around the PostOffice system
    • Providing guidance around associated payment devices (i.e. HSMs)
    • Leading a team that improves general Postilion availability
    • Leading a team that improves transaction throughput and success rates
    • Ensuring compliance and adherence to PCI-DSS requirements
    • Respond to and resolve incidents and problems timeously
    • Prevent recurring incidents
    • Ensure that correct monitoring levels are in place and actively monitored
    • Identify and run proactive projects to improve the overall team

    Broader IT Team

    • Interacting with full IT team to deliver quality service and solutions to business and customers
    • Providing technical guidance, input and architecture around Postilion & PostOffice system
    • Actively contribute to the success of the team and promote “new ways of work” e.g. DevOps, Agile, etc.
    • Assisting and growing IT to become a strategic partner and enabler to business

    Business Optimisation

    • Working with relevant Business and IT teams to improve customer experience and channel availability
    • Working with business, banking partners and card associations to improve transaction throughput and success rates
    • Design and implementation of additional revenue driving products and transaction types in conjunction with business

    Effective People Management

    • Ensure that all roles and responsibilities are clear and that the resources are aligned with business requirements and strategy
    • Develop effective practices for career development and performance management
    • Managing Standby resources, activities and rostering

    Process Optimisation

    • Manage the capacity of the Postilion Team
    • Manage the capacity of the Postilion and PostOffice systems
    • Manage and implement the correct patches following the appropriate patch management methodologies without placing the organization at risk
    • Ensure that all events are effectively monitored, managed and communicated

    Documentation

    • Keep system documentation up to date and current including all changes (centralised on Confluence)
    • Update the operational run books for each system
    • Capture changes timeously and with the correct level of detail, urgency and care.
    • Monthly reporting and data collation on system and team performance.

    General

    • Liaise with external partners (banks, telco’s etc.) in assisting with new projects / implementations.
    • Liase with external partners driving incidents until resolution (key is to be proactively reducing the mean Time to Repair)
    • Communicating with Group CIO on a regular basis
    • Communicating with users and general business with regards to incidents and problems
    • Finding innovative ways to improve the current ways of working
    • Finding solutions to improve cardholder experience and transaction success rates
    • General understanding of cryptography and security
    • General understanding of Electronic Funds Transfer mechanisms

    In order to be considered for the position, the following requirements must be met:

    • BTech IT or relevant B. degree with an IT focus
    • Performing a Technical management function including managing a team
    • Min 5 years’ experience in running a Postilion Real-Time Switch or similar processing software (e.g. Base24, CR2, BPC, etc.) - preferably with a mixture of ATM and POS experience
    • Min 3 years’ experience in running Postilion Office or similar back-office system

    Technical Competencies:

    • Windows Server 2008, 2012
    • MS SQL 2008, 2012, 2016
    • Postilion Real-Time (or similar system)
    • Postilion Office (or similar system)
    • HSM Administration
    • Basic Networking
    • Confluence and Jira
